Understanding the HSA Health Plan: A Comprehensive Guide

Health Savings Account (HSA) is a tax-advantaged savings account that allows individuals to save for medical expenses while enjoying certain tax benefits. It is designed to work in conjunction with a high deductible health plan (HDHP), providing a way for individuals to pay for qualified medical expenses with pre-tax dollars.

Here are some key features of the HSA health plan:

  • Contributions to an HSA are tax-deductible
  • Funds in the account can be invested and grow tax-free
  • Withdrawals for qualified medical expenses are tax-free
  • Unused funds rollover year to year, unlike FSA

Having an HSA can offer individuals more control over their healthcare costs and savings, providing flexibility and peace of mind when it comes to managing medical expenses.

It's important to note that not everyone is eligible for an HSA. To qualify, you must be enrolled in an HDHP, not be covered by another health plan, not be claimed as a dependent on someone else's tax return, and not be enrolled in Medicare.

Understanding how an HSA health plan works can help individuals make informed decisions about their healthcare and finances, ultimately leading to better savings and a sense of security.
